Abstract:
An electronic device may include electrical components and other components mounted within an interior of a housing. The device may have a display on a front face of the device and may have a glass layer that forms part of the housing on a rear face of the device. The glass layer may be provided with regions having different appearances. The regions may be textured, may have coatings such as thin-film interference filter coatings formed from stacks of dielectric material having alternating indices of refraction, may have metal coating layers, and/or may have ink coating layers. Textured surfaces may be formed on thin glass layers and polymer films that are coupled to the glass layer. A glass layer may be formed from a pair of coupled glass layers. The coupled layers may have one or more recesses or other structures to visually distinguish different regions of the glass layer.
